Lester J . McKee is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Environmental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Lester J . McKee has authored 67 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Water Science and Technology, 18 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 12 papers in Environmental Engineering. Recurrent topics in Lester J . McKee's work include Mercury impact and mitigation studies (14 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(13 papers) and Urban Stormwater Management Solutions (9 papers). Lester J . McKee is often cited by papers focused on Mercury impact and mitigation studies (14 papers), Toxic Organic Pollutants Impact (13 papers) and Urban Stormwater Management Solutions (9 papers). Lester J . McKee coll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Bangladesh. Lester J . McKee's co-authors include Bradley D. Eyre, David H. Schoellhamer, Alicia N. Gilbreath, Neil K. Ganju, Shahadat Hossain, Donald Yee, Jay A Davis, J. J. Oram, Shahadat Hossain and Bruce E. Jaffe and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Earth and Planetary Science Letters and Limnology and Oceanography.
